Brown v. Boeing Company
Plaintiff: Arlene M. Brown
Defendant: Boeing Company
Case Number: 2:2017cv01354
Filed: September 8, 2017
Court: US District Court for the Western District of Washington
Office: Seattle Office
County: King
Presiding Judge: Ricardo S Martinez
Nature of Suit: Employee Retirement Income Security Act of 1974
Cause of Action: 29 U.S.C. ยง 1132
Jury Demanded By: Plaintiff

Date Filed Document Text
December 4, 2019 Opinion or Order Filing 85 ORDER dismissing matter per parties' 84 Stipulation of Dismissal with Prejudice. Signed by Judge Ricardo S. Martinez. (PM)
November 20, 2019 Opinion or Order Filing 83 ORDER granting parties' 82 Stipulated Motion to Extend Deadlines on Remand. The Parties are directed to file a joint status report no later than January 3, 2020. Signed by Judge Ricardo S. Martinez. (PM)
October 16, 2019 Opinion or Order Filing 81 ORDER granting Parties' 80 Stipulated Motion to Extend Deadlines on Remand. The Parties are directed to file a joint status report no later than January 3, 2020. Signed by Judge Ricardo S. Martinez. (PM)
September 17, 2019 Opinion or Order Filing 79 ORDER granting parties' 78 Stipulated Motion to Extend Deadlines on Remand. The Parties are directed to file a joint status report no later than January 3, 2020. Signed by Judge Ricardo S. Martinez. (PM)
June 4, 2019 Opinion or Order Filing 77 ORDER granting Parties' 76 Stipulated Motion to Stay the Case Pending Remand to the Employee Benefit Plans Committee. Joint Status Report due within 180 days. Signed by Judge Ricardo S. Martinez. (PM)
February 20, 2019 Opinion or Order Filing 65 ORDER granting Plaintiff's 64 Motion to Extend Deadline. Plaintiff may move to reopen discovery no later than March 14, 2019. Signed by Judge Ricardo S. Martinez. (PM)
January 15, 2019 Opinion or Order Filing 57 ORDER referring matter to the Court's Pro Bono Coordinator to identify an attorney from the Pro BonoPanel to represent Plaintiff. Signed by Judge Ricardo S. Martinez. (PM) cc: Plaintiff via first class mail
November 1, 2018 Opinion or Order Filing 54 ORDER granting parties' 53 Stipulated Motion to Extend Current Trial Calendar: Bench Trial is CONTINUED to 3/18/2019. Motions in Limine due by 2/18/2019, Pretrial Order due by 3/6/2019, Trial briefs to be submitted by 3/13/2019, Proposed Findings of Fact and Conclusions of Law to be submitted by 3/13/2019, signed by Judge Ricardo S. Martinez. (SWT) (cc: Plaintiff via USPS)
April 10, 2018 Opinion or Order Filing 29 STIPULATED PROTECTIVE ORDER signed by Judge Ricardo S Martinez. (PM) cc: plaintiff via first class mail
December 6, 2017 Opinion or Order Filing 18 ORDER granting 17 Stipulated Motion for Extension of Time. The parties' deadline to file any motions to strike under FRCP 12(f) is extended to February 15, 2018. The deadline to respond to any motions under FRCP 12(f) is extended to March 8, 2018. Signed by Judge Ricardo S Martinez. (PM) cc: plaintiff via first class mail
October 27, 2017 Opinion or Order Filing 13 ORDER granting 12 Stipulated Motion to Extend Deadlines. Amended Complaint due by 11/15/2017, Response to Amended Complaint due 12/21/2017, FRCP 26f Conference Deadline is 1/17/2018, Initial Disclosure Deadline is 1/24/2018, Combined Joint Status Report due by 1/31/2018. Signed by Chief Judge Ricardo S Martinez. (PM) Modified on 10/27/2017: copy sent to plaintiff via first class mail (PM).
October 25, 2017 Opinion or Order Filing 11 ORDER granting 10 Stipulated Motion for extension of deadlines. FRCP 26f Conference Deadline is 11/30/2017, Initial Disclosure Deadline is 12/8/2017, Combined Joint Status Report due by 12/19/2017, signed by Chief Judge Ricardo S Martinez. (PM) Modified on 10/25/2017: copy to plaintiff via first class mail (PM).
September 29, 2017 Opinion or Order Filing 5 ORDER granting 4 Stipulated Motion extending deadline until 10/31/2017 for Defendants to file responses to complaint. Signed by Judge Ricardo S Martinez. (PM) cc: plaintiff via the U.S. Mail
